Kevin Bridges in conversation with Colin Murray
Saturday 11 October, 12.30pm
Glasgow Royal Concert Hall
The wildly popular Glasgow comic joins Talksport’s Colin Murray to discuss his brilliantly funny memoir, We Need to talk about…Kevin Bridges, packed with scrapes, pranks and side-splitting anecdotes.
Tickets cost £23 (plus booking fee) and get you a signed copy of the book.
